Job Summary

Cross-trains in various logistics support tasks. Works with a focus in one or more areas, which include receiving, releasing, inventory, t-zone, etc. at various Company distribution center locations.

Essential Duties and Responsibilities

Receiving:

  • Generates labels and purchase orders from vendor receipts to be used by order checkers for verification.
  • Schedules and manages appointments with vendors.
  • Verifies the manifest and works closely with category management to resolve overage issues.
  • Locates slots for new product and collects measurements from order checkers. Enters specs into software system and produces required receiving documents.

Releasing:

  • Processes and modifies retail store orders from the warehouse management system (WMS) to create a router, which summarizes the sequence of dock departs.
  • Releases processed orders from WMS to Vocollect system.
  • Calculates cubic weight to manually create separate orders in the computer system for overflow inventory.

Inventory:

  • Counts selection slots once a period and reserves once a quarter.
  • Verifies that slots are either filled or empty according to specified placements.
  • Runs a count of an aisle range and checks for empty reserved slots. Finds solutions to ensure proper inventory count to achieve an accuracy goal.

T-Zone:

  • Receives notice from logistics partners regarding products that do not fit in the reserved slot. Abandons product in the computer system and notates the reason for abandonment.
  • Researches and resolves product placement issues to assign proper slots to goods.
